Sabri Lamouchi names final 26-man Tunisia squad for FIFA World Cup

The Eagles of Carthage face Japan, the Netherlands and Sweden in Group F when the tournament kicks off in June.

Lamouchi guided his side to the global showpiece as winners of Group H ahead of Nambia, Liberia, Malawi, Equatorial Guinea and Sao Tome and Principe.

Included in the squad are Paris Saint-Germain winger Khalil Ayari, Union Berlin midfielder Rani Khedira, Frankfurt midfielder Ellyes Skhiri and Burnley's Hannibal Mejbri.

Missing out though are the likes of experienced Al-Gharafa midfielder Ferjani Sassi, former captain Yassine Meriah and veteran winger Naim Sliti.

Full Tunisia World Cup squad:

Goalkeepers: Aymen Dahmen (CS Sfaxien), Sabri Ben Hassine (Étoile du Sahel), Mohib Al-Shamikhi (Club Africain)

Defenders: Montassar Talbi (Lorient), Dylan Bronn (Servette), Omar Rekik (Maribor), Yan Valery (Young Boys), Ali Abdi (Nice), Moataz Nafati (IFK Norrköping), Raed Sheikhawi (US Monastir), Adem Arous (Kasimpasa)

Midfielders: Ellyes Skhiri (Eintracht Frankfurt), Hannibal Mejbri (Burnley), Amine Ben Hamida (Espérance de Tunis), Anis Ben Slimane (Norwich City), Mohamed Haj Mahmoud (Lugano), Rani Khedira (Union Berlin), Mortadha Ben Ouanes (Kasimpasa)

Forwards: Elias Achouri (Copenhagen), Ismael Gharbi (FC Augsburg), Elyes Saad (Hannover 96), Sebastian Tounekti (Celtic), Firas Chaouat (Club Africain), Khalil Ayari (Paris Saint-Germain), Hazem Mestouri (Dynamo Makhachkala), Rayan Loumi (Vancouver Whitecaps)
